Abstract
The utility model discloses a kind of precircuit teaching aids.Wherein, this method comprises: cover card and back cover card, the cover card are covered in the top of the back cover card, which is provided with predetermined pattern, it is provided with circuit diagram on the back cover card, which includes preinstalled circuit model and circuit model to be designed;The predetermined pattern matches with the circuit diagram;The predetermined position of the cover card is arranged the preinstalled circuit element of the circuit diagram, and the predetermined pattern is to be folded into the model of three-dimensional shape by lines as indicated.The utility model solves the teaching aid excessively complexity, uninteresting while at high cost technical problem when underage child carries out circuit learning.

For the figure that can be folded into three-dimensional shape, in a kind of optional embodiment, which is being capable of line as indicated
Item is folded into the figure of three-dimensional shape.Cover card before folding forms three-dimensional hollow out knot as shown in figure 3, in design process
The figure of structure is the new shop building schematic model of science and technology center, is also possible to other contour of building, can be landscape, can be animation
Role etc..The each basic unit for forming three-dimensional engraved structure is separated, in stereochemical structure paper mockup folding process, tool
Body requirement are as follows: dotted line represents: folding upwards;Chain-dotted line represents: folding downwards;Heavy line represents: cutting off.Folded cover card is such as
Shown in Fig. 4, eventually by the conversion that can be realized from 2D structure to 3D structure is folded, the three-dimensional contouring that height rises and falls is generated.It is excellent
Selection of land, predetermined pattern are science and technology center's profiles.
Machine cross cutting can be carried out to the part for using scissors to cut off in structure in advance in above-mentioned design process, in this way
When student's operation, it is possible to reduce operating time and operation difficulty.After factory carries out batch cross cutting, student takes production
Material can directly be torn it down each structural unit with hand, and it is hidden using the waste of brought time and safety to avoid scissors
Suffer from.

In a kind of optional embodiment, which includes conductive paper/electrically conductive ink, LED lamp and battery.
In circuit design process, electronic component different in circuit is showed with different shape and color, makes the letter of expression
It ceases apparent.Circuit connection conductive paper or conductive oil writing brush, power supply button cell, the light-emitting component on circuit use LED
Lamp, LED light expose (the hollow out position that need to design solid figure is corresponding with the position of LED light) by the hollow out of cover card,
It can see when LED light is bright.Data packet (ticker tape, battery, LED light, conductive paper, electrically conductive ink are provided when student makes
Pen), introduce operating instruction, etc. added texts, learn student can with complete independently in use.Meanwhile each paper matrix
Circuit model is exactly two complete paper before production, and being formed after completing the production has scientific, aesthetics three-dimensional hollow out
Structural circuit paper mockup.
In a kind of optional embodiment, which includes acoustical generator.The acoustical generator is set to back cover
It, can be with the folding of back cover card, trigger switch, so that the teaching aid plays voice after production at the fold line of card
Or music, student can design circuit using the acoustical generator in material packet as target combination preinstalled circuit model, from
And teach through lively activities, make the hunting circuit model that child is positive, and excite the creativity of child, this is letter with previous teaching aid
Single demonstration has very big difference.
